Highlights of the National Capital Region (NCR) Population 2024 …

Web23 aug. 2024 · Among the 16 highly urbanized cities (HUCs) comprising the NCR, Quezon City had the biggest population in 2024 with 2,960,048 persons, followed by the City of Manila with 1,846,513 persons, and the City of Caloocan with 1,661,584 persons. The City of San Juan had the smallest population with 126,347 persons. WebThe last time a global survey was attempted – by the United Nations in 2005 – an estimated 100 million people were homeless worldwide. As many as 1.6 billion people lacked adequate housing (Habitat, 2015). In 2024, the World Economic Forum reported that 150 million people were homeless worldwide. Web2 jul. 2024 · The Philippines is one of the fastest-growing economies in Southeast Asia, yet it is facing a homeless crisis. There are approximately 4.5 million homeless people, including children, in the Philippines, which has a population of 106 million people. Homelessness in the Philippines is caused by a variety of reasons, including lost jobs, insufficient income …
